B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
1. Technical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to novel cosmetic compositions for topical application, for photoprotecting the skin and/or the hair against ultraviolet radiation (such compositions hereinafter simply designated “antisun,” “sunscreen” or “photoprotective” compositions), and to the use of same for the cosmetic applications indicated above.
This invention more especially relates to the aforesaid sunscreen/cosmetic compositions comprising, formulated into a cosmetically acceptable vehicle, diluent or carrier therefor, a tripartite combination of (a) benzene-1,4-bis(3-methylidene-10-camphorsulfonic acid), optionally in partially or totally neutralized form, as a first screening agent, (b) at least one bisresorcinyltriazine compound as a second screening agent, and (c) as a third screening agent, at least one compound containing at least two benzazolyl groups or a compound containing at least one benzodiazolyl group, the said first, second and third screening agents being present in the subject compositions in proportions suitable for eliciting a synergistic effect with regard to the protection factors imparted.
2. Description of the Prior Art
It is known to this art that light radiation of wavelengths of from 280 nm to 400 nm promotes tanning of the human epidermis and that irradiation with wavelengths of from 280 to 320 nm, i.e., UV-B radiation, causes skin burns and erythema which may be harmful to the development of a natural tan; this UV-B radiation should thus be screened from the skin.
It is also known to this art that UV-A radiation, with wavelengths of from 320 to 400 nm, which causes tanning of the skin, also adversely affects it, in particular in the case of sensitive skin or of skin which is continually exposed to solar radiation. UV-A rays in particular cause a loss of skin elasticity and the appearance of wrinkles, resulting in premature aging. Such irradiation promotes triggering of the erythemal reaction or amplifies this reaction in certain individuals and may even be the cause of phototoxic or photoallergic reactions. It is thus desirable to also screen out UV-A radiation.
A wide variety of cosmetic compositions for photoprotecting (against UV-A and/or UV-B) the skin are known to this art.
These photoprotective/sunscreen compositions are typically emulsions of oil-in-water type (i.e., a cosmetically acceptable support (vehicle, diluent or carrier) comprising an aqueous dispersing continuous phase and an oily dispersed discontinuous phase) which contains, in various concentrations, one or more conventional lipophilic and/or hydrophilic organic screening agents capable of selectively absorbing harmful UV radiation, these screening agents (and the amounts thereof) being selected as a function of the desired protection factor (the protection factor (PF) being expressed mathematically by the ratio of the irradiation time required to attain the erythema-forming threshold with the UV screening agent to the time required to attain the erythema-forming threshold without a UV screening agent).
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
It has now surprisingly and unexpectedly been determined that a tripartite combination of three specific sunscreens already per se known to this art provides synergistically active sunscreen compositions exhibiting markedly improved protection factors.
Briefly, the present invention features novel cosmetic compositions, in particular photoprotective/sunscreen compositions, comprising, in a cosmetically acceptable vehicle, diluent or carrier, (a) benzene-1,4-bis(3-methylidene-10-camphorsulfonic acid), optionally in partially or totally neutralized form, as a first screening agent, (b) at least one bisresorcinyltriazine compound as a second screening agent, and (c) as a third screening agent, at least one compound containing at least two benzoazolyl groups or a compound containing at least one benzodiazolyl group, the said first, second and third screening agents being formulated into the subject compositions in proportions which elicit a synergistic effect with regard to the protection factors imparted.
The present invention also features the use of the subject compositions for the production of cosmetic compositions suited for photoprotecting the skin and/or the hair against the deleterious effects of ultraviolet radiation, in particular solar radiation.
This invention thus also features a cosmetic regime/regimen for photoprotecting the skin and/or the hair against the damaging effect of ultraviolet radiation, in particular solar radiation, which essentially entails topically applying onto the skin/hair an effective photoprotecting amount of a composition in accordance herewith.
D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F BEST MODE AND SPECIFIC/P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S OF THE INVENTION
More particularly according to the present invention, novel cosmetic or dermatological compositions, in particular sunscreen/antisun compositions, are now provided, comprising, formulated into vehicle, diluent or carrier therefor:
(a) benzene-1,4-bis(3-methylidene-10-camphorsulfonic acid), optionally in partially or totally neutralized form, as a first screening agent;
(b) as a second screening agent, at least one bisresorcinyltriazine compound;
(c) as a third screening agent, at least one compound containing at least two benzoazolyl groups per molecule and/or at least one compound containing, per molecule, at least one benzodiazolyl group, the said first, second and third screening agents being formulated into the subject compositions in proportions which elicit a synergistic effect with regard to the sun protection factors imparted.
By the expression “containing at least two benzazolyl groups” are intended, per molecule, at least two groups of the benzoxazolyl, benzothiazolyl or benzimidazolyl type.
By the expression “containing at least one benzodiazolyl group” is intended, per molecule, one group of the benzodioxazolyl, benzodithiazolyl or benzodiimidazolyl type.
Benzene-1,4-bis(3-methylidene-10-camphorsulfonic acid) and the various salts thereof, described, in particular, in FR-A-2,528,420 and FR-A-2,639,347, are screening agents that are already known per se (so-called broad-band screening agents) which are capable of absorbing ultraviolet radiation with wavelengths of from 280 to 400 nm, with absorption maxima of from 320 to 400 nm, in particular at about 345 nm.
